Swedish band In Flames are putting out a DVD, due for release this June, entitled 'A Night In Flames'. This DVD will document the world tour In Flames undertook last year (a tour in which Adelaide was fortunate to be one of the cities visited), and from the sounds of it, will contain footage of the last show the band performed on that tour: a show in London on 27 December which also featured Chimaira, Lacuna Coil, and Caliban.
In the last column, passing mention was made
of local death/grind band Omnium Gatherum's decision to shorten
their name to simply Omnium. According to the band, the name
change was prompted by the signing of an Omnium Gatherum from
Finland to the Nuclear Blast label, and an understandable desire
to avoid confusion between the two groups. Details of a new
band website will be available soon. A reminder that O.G. will
play their first show as Omnium on Sat 29 Jan at the Enigma
Bar with Victoria's Steel Affliction, Imminent Psychosis, and
Blood Mason.
'Alien', the latest release of Canadian band Strapping Young Lad, will be out on 21 March. The eleven-track album will feature the combined talents of band front-man Devin Townsend, guitarist Jed Simon, drummer Gene Hoglan and bass player Bryon Stroud, and according to Townsend will be the group's "most maniacal and outlandish offering to date."
An early announcement here for 'Metal Easter',
an all-ages show brought to you by DaBigPig Promotions, and
to be held at Fowlers Live on Sun 27 Mar. The event, which will
also be the official launch of Delirium Clothing, will feature
ten bands. More details as they come to hand.
